RED RAY Optical Disk Drive
Posted on Apr 14, 08 06:30 PM PDT

RED RAY has just rolled out a new optical disk drive that claims to playback 4K video from the RED ONE, 3K video from the new Scarlet and the usual assortment of HD formats from RED Disc and RED Express media, in addition to native R3D RAW files from CompactFlash. It seems that 5K video from the new EPIC is not supported, which could be a bummer for some. Specifications have not yet been finalized though, so stay tuned as more developments occur.
